Orlando Pirates have triggered an option on Tshegofatso Mabasa‘s contract following his return from rivals Moroka Swallows.

This is according to a report by iDiski Times, who suggests that Mabasa’s contract was set to expire in June.
Now, having extended the initial contract by two more years, Pirates know they have a natural striker for the next two years.

“Orlando Pirates have activated a two-year option in the contract of striker Tshegofatso Mabasa, whose deal was expiring at the end of the current season,” reads part of the report.

Mabasa is amongst the leading goalscorers in the league with six goals – all scored during his brief stint with Swallows.

He is two goals behind Cape Town City’s Khanyisa Mayo who is currently sitting with eight league goals.
The left-footed frontman will now hope to add to the tally in the remaining matches of the season with Pirates.
